History & Origin

Sheronda is a modern coinage rather than a traditional name. It fuses the She-/Sha- opening popular in the mid-twentieth century with the -onda ending of Rhonda. Names made this way prized rhythm and freshness over any dictionary root.

Sheronda was most common around 1974 and had faded by the end of the century. A woman named Sheronda at the peak is about fifty today. It is a distinctly seventies invention and has not been revived.

Did you know? Sheronda pairs two mid-century sounds β€” the She-/Sha- prefix and the -onda of Rhonda β€” into one flowing name, a hallmark of the inventive African-American naming of its day.
